Frequently Asked Questions about Gay Street

What type of rentals are currently available in Gay Street?

There are currently 1516 Apartments for Rent in Gay Street, MD with pricing that ranges from $715 to $12,810. There are also 491 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Gay Street ranging from $475 to $35,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Gay Street?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Gay Street ranges from $475 to $35,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,398.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Gay Street?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Gay Street range from $1,100 to $6,345,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$700 to $7,900.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,175.
